Definition and Core Components
A ‘Centennial Colorado Personal Injury Lawyer’ refers to a legal professional specializing in representing individuals who have suffered harm due to another party’s negligence or intentional actions. This practice area encompasses a wide range of legal services, including:
- Car Accidents: Dealing with injuries sustained in motor vehicle collisions, involving cars, trucks, or motorcycles.
- Pedestrian and Bicycle Injuries: Protecting the rights of individuals injured while on foot or cycling.
- Medical Malpractice: Holding healthcare providers accountable for negligence leading to patient harm.
- Premises Liability: Addressing accidents occurring on someone else’s property due to unsafe conditions.
- Product Liability: Suing manufacturers or sellers for defects in products that cause injuries.
- Workplace Injuries: Assisting employees injured on the job and advocating for their rights.
Historical Context and Significance
The roots of personal injury law can be traced back to ancient Roman and English common law traditions, where remedies were developed to compensate victims for losses. Over centuries, this body of law evolved, gaining significance in modern times due to several factors:
- Increasing Complexity: As society became more industrialized and mobile, road accidents, workplace hazards, and medical errors became more prevalent, necessitating specialized legal expertise.
- Growth of Consumer Rights: The rise of consumer protection laws and regulations empowered individuals to seek justice for product defects or service failures.
- Medical Advancements: With advancements in medicine, survivors of previously fatal injuries now sought legal redress, leading to a broader definition of negligence and liability.
In Colorado, the legal framework for personal injury cases is governed by state laws, including the Colorado Revised Statutes, which outline the rights and responsibilities of individuals involved in accidents or harmed by others’ actions. Regulatory Frameworks
Navigating regulatory requirements is a critical aspect of ‘Centennial Colorado Personal Injury Lawyer’ practice:
State Laws and Regulations
- Statutes of Limitations: Colorado has specific time limits for filing personal injury lawsuits, which vary according to the type of case. For example, medical malpractice claims typically have shorter statutes than car accident cases.
- Discovery Rules: The state’s rules of civil procedure govern the process of exchanging information between parties, ensuring a fair trial.
- Insurance Regulations: Colorado’s Department of Insurance oversees insurance practices, including rates and claim handling, which impact personal injury cases.
Professional Conduct Rules
- Ethical Standards: Lawyers must adhere to the Colorado Rules of Professional Conduct, ensuring honest representation, confidentiality, and avoiding conflicts of interest.
- Continuing Legal Education: Mandatory continuing legal education ensures that attorneys stay updated on changes in the law and best practices.
Challenges and Overcoming Them
‘Centennial Colorado Personal Injury Lawyers’ face several challenges in their practice:
Complex Cases and Expertise
- Medical Complexity: Understanding intricate medical issues and translating them into legal arguments requires specialized knowledge.
- Expert Testimony: Obtaining credible expert witnesses who can articulate complex matters in a court of law is a significant challenge.
Insurance Company Resistance
- Claims Handling: Insurance companies often employ aggressive tactics to deny or minimize claims, requiring lawyers to be adept at negotiation and litigation.
- Subrogation Claims: Dealing with subrogation rights, where insurance companies seek recovery from third parties responsible for an accident, adds complexity.
Balancing Client Expectations and Results
- Client Communication: Managing client expectations is crucial, as personal injury cases can be lengthy and have varying outcomes. Effective communication ensures client satisfaction.
- Case Settlements: While some clients prefer trials, others may opt for settlements. Lawyers must balance the potential benefits of a trial against the certainty of a settlement.
